iMac G5, 20-inch Troubleshooting - 33

Symptom Charts

10. Does the computer start up normally after pressing the internal power button?

Yes: Press and hold the power button until the computer powers off.

• Unplug the power cord from the iMac, and reinstall the back cover.

• Return the computer to the upright position.

• Plug the computer back in, and press the power button to turn on the computer.

• Make sure the computer is starting up properly. If the computer will ONLY start up

from the internal power but will not power on from the power button on the back

cover, the power button on the back cover may be faulty. Go to step 13

No: Press the SMU reset button to reset system power management. The SMU is the

small metal button (shown below) located below the internal power button.

11. After pressing the SMU button, press the internal power button again. Does the

computer start up normally now?

Yes: Press and hold the power button until the machine powers off.

• Unplug the power cord from the iMac, and replace the back cover.

• Return the computer to the upright position.

• Plug the in the computer, and press the power button to turn on the computer.

• Make sure the computer is starting up properly. If the computer will ONLY start up

from the internal power but will not power on from the power button on the back

cover, this may indicate that the power button on the back cover is faulty. Got to

step 13.

No: Go to the next step.

12. Unplug the power from the iMac G5 and remove the internal hard drive and set it

aside. Plug in the iMac G5, and using the Internal power button as before, power on

the iMac G5. Does the iMac G5 start up now?
